2009-11-19 2 views
0

현재 BTS 어셈블리 인 파이프 라인 어셈블리를 사용하는 사용자 지정 파이프 라인 구성 요소를 사용하여 내 BTS 응용 프로그램에서 해독/암호화 및 서명 유효성 검사가 구현되었습니다. 메시지 암호화/해독 하나의 메시지가 인증/유효화되면 메시지를 BTS 응용 프로그램에 보내 추가 처리를 수행 할 수 있지만 BTS 어셈블리를 사용하여 암호 해독/암호화가 완료 될 때까지 기다릴 수 있습니다..NET에서 BizTalk 파이프 라인 구성 요소 호출 C#

아마도이 논리를 다시 작성해야합니다. .NET C# 또는 .NET 웹 서비스 계층 상자에서 동일한 구현을 사용할 수있는 방법이 있습니까? BTS 애플리케이션은 비즈니스 프로세스를 수행 할 것이며, 오버 헤드 메시지 암호화/암호 해독이없는 것, 따라서 위의 질문 그래서

답변

0

당신은 항상 .NET의 system.security를 ​​사용하여 암호화/암호 해독 자신을 할 수 있습니다. 암호화 네임 스페이스 : http://msdn.microsoft.com/en-us/library/system.security.cryptography.aspx. 하지만 난 항상 사용하기가 약간 힘들다는 것을 알았습니다. CodePlex에서 모든 것을 단순화하는 래퍼가있을 수 있습니다.

저는 현재 은행에 있으며 웹 서비스 메서드 호출을 통해 사용자 데이터를받는 WCF 외부 웹 서비스를 보유하고 있습니다. 여기서는 인증서를 사용하고 있으며 WCF가이 모든 것을 처리합니다 (Microsoft에서 한 두 번의 지원 호출을 통해). IIS가 SSL을 처리합니다. 그러나 웹 서비스에서 PGP 나 다른 암호화/암호 해독을 사용할 수도 있습니다.

관련 문제